2. Services Provided
Getbeel ("the Service") is a platform that uses artificial intelligence to automate accounts payable processes for businesses and professionals. By using Getbeel, users may access the following features:
- Email scanning and invoice extraction: Getbeel connects to the User's email inbox through authorized email provider APIs (e.g., Gmail API, Outlook API) to identify and extract invoice-related emails. The extraction is performed exclusively through a Semantic Search algorithm, as described in detail in Section 3.
- Invoice management: Extracted invoices are organized and stored within the Getbeel platform in the "All Invoices" section, where Users can view, categorize, and manage their accounts payable documentation.
- Bank statement reconciliation: Users may upload bank statements to the platform. An artificial intelligence system then performs automated matching between the uploaded bank statement transactions and the extracted invoices to facilitate reconciliation.
- Electronic invoicing (Italy): For entities subject to mandatory electronic invoicing in Italy, Getbeel enables the issuance and transmission of electronic invoices through the Sistema di Interscambio (SDI).
- Self-invoicing of foreign invoices: For businesses with their registered office in Italy, Getbeel facilitates the self-invoicing process for invoices received from foreign suppliers, in compliance with Italian tax regulations.
- Dashboard and reporting: Getbeel provides Users with dashboards and reporting tools to monitor their accounts payable status, outstanding payments, and reconciliation progress.
- Team collaboration: The platform supports collaboration among multiple Authorized Users, allowing teams to work together on accounts payable management in a coordinated manner.

3. Platform Architecture and Data Processing
This section describes how Getbeel accesses, processes, and stores data in connection with the Services. Users are encouraged to read this section carefully.
3.1 - Email access and OAuth authentication
Getbeel connects to the User's email inbox exclusively through the official APIs provided by the User's email provider (e.g., Gmail API, Microsoft Outlook API, or other supported providers). Access is granted only upon explicit User authorization through a secure OAuth 2.0 authentication process. When the User initiates the connection (e.g., by clicking "Connect Gmail"), the email provider displays a consent screen that clearly describes the specific permissions being granted to Getbeel. Upon authorization, the email provider issues an access token — a secure digital credential that allows Getbeel to access the User's inbox in a limited and controlled manner. At no point does Getbeel receive, store, or have access to the User's email password.
3.2 - Scope of email access permissions
Getbeel requests the minimum level of permissions necessary to perform its functions. For Gmail, Getbeel operates under the gmail.readonly scope, which permits reading email messages and metadata but does not permit sending, modifying, deleting or otherwise altering any email content or inbox settings. Getbeel cannot send emails on the User's behalf, cannot delete messages, and cannot modify the User's mailbox in any way. Google classifies this scope as "Restricted", which requires Getbeel to undergo and pass a rigorous security verification process conducted by Google before being authorized to use such scope in production. Getbeel has successfully completed this security verification, through which Google has validated that Getbeel's access is limited to emails matching specific semantic search parameters as described in Section 3.3 below. Equivalent read-only permissions and provider verification processes apply for Microsoft Outlook and other supported email providers.
3.3 - Semantic search
Once email access is authorized, Getbeel employs a proprietary Semantic Search algorithm to identify emails that may contain invoices or receipts. This algorithm operates by cross-referencing two parameters configured by the User: (i) the name of the supplier or provider, and (ii) the keywords "invoice" or "receipt" (or equivalent terms based on the User's language and semantic search preferences). The Semantic Search is not powered by artificial intelligence. It is a deterministic, rule-based algorithm that matches emails against the User's configured parameters. Getbeel cannot and does not read emails that do not match these semantic search parameters.
3.4 - Non-matching emails: strict inaccessibility
Emails that do not match the parameters of the Semantic Search are not read, not opened, not exported, and not processed in any way. Such emails remain under the exclusive control of the User and are entirely inaccessible to the Getbeel platform, its algorithms, and any artificial intelligence system used by Getbeel. For the avoidance of doubt, Getbeel's artificial intelligence systems have no access whatsoever to the User's email inbox. AI is used only from the extraction process onwards, when Getbeel's algorithm has already identified the invoices to be extracted. Therefore, the artificial intelligence systems have no access at any time to the User's email inbox.
3.5 - Invoice extraction and storage
Only emails that match the Semantic Search parameters are processed. The invoice-related information contained in such emails (e.g., supplier name, invoice number, amounts, dates, VAT numbers, payment terms) is extracted and transferred to the Getbeel platform, where it is stored and displayed in the "All Invoices" section of the User's account.
3.6 - Bank statement upload and AI-powered reconciliation
The User may upload bank statements directly to the Getbeel platform (via file upload or, where available, through authorized banking integrations). Once both invoice data and bank statement data are available within the platform, Getbeel's artificial intelligence system performs automated reconciliation by matching bank statement transactions with extracted invoices based on amounts, dates, supplier references, and other relevant data points. The AI reconciliation operates exclusively on data already present within the Getbeel platform and does not access the User's email inbox or any external source.
